Le 20/11/2019 à 13:58, Taylor Simpson a écrit :
> Is there a precedent for this? I'm OK with DEBUG_HEX, but I assumed
> reviewers wouldn't approve
> #ifdef FIXME
> #define DEBUG_HEX
> #endif
For instance, in target/mips/translate.c you have:
42
43 #define MIPS_DEBUG_DISAS 0
44
...
2603 #define LOG_DISAS(...) \
2604 do { \
2605 if (MIPS_DEBUG_DISAS) { \
2606 qemu_log_mask(CPU_LOG_TB_IN_ASM, ## __VA_ARGS__);\
2607 } \
2608 } while (0)
2609
...
10121 LOG_DISAS("mftr (reg %d u %d sel %d h %d)\n", rt, u, sel,
h);
...
For the linux-user part, I don't think you need the DEBUG_HEX traces.
